## Connection Pool Verification

Before approving the release, confirm that the Tidepool connection pooler has drained gracefully on all three Quillbrook database replicas. Pool size must not exceed 120 per node; anything higher indicates a leaked session from the previous deploy. If the idle-connection count stays above 40 for more than five minutes, halt the rollout and page the data platform rotation. The full drain procedure is documented on the internal page below.

operations page: https://jira.lumiclabs.internal/pages/display/projects/af69ce92

**Q: ParityScope flagged a rate mismatch — is it real?**

Usually yes, but verify first. ParityScope compares the Dovetail Inns direct rate against aggregator feeds every 15 minutes; a single stale feed can produce a false positive. Check the feed timestamps before escalating to the revenue team. Mismatches older than two hours auto-escalate regardless. The verification checklist and feed status dashboard are maintained on the internal page.

runbook for tafof-yawif: https://confluence.tolvaqsys.internal/display/display/browse/pages/7be3

## Account Recovery — Trailnote Offline Mode

When a surveyor's Trailnote app has been offline for 30+ days, their local credentials expire and sync refuses to resume. Don't make them wipe the device — all their unsynced field data lives there! Instead, open the support console, pick "Offline Reinstate," and enter their handle. The console will ask for the support team's shared recovery passphrase before issuing a reinstatement token. Use the one below.

unlock words, bagaf-fajeg: zorael-kelax-fraath-quenix-eliok-sileth-aldmir-wenir-druiel

## Rate Limiting — Gatekite Gateway

The Gatekite internal API gateway enforces per-client rate limits configured via environment variables. RATE_WINDOW_SECONDS and RATE_MAX_REQUESTS control the sliding window; defaults are 60 and 500. Release managers must confirm both values in the staging env file before tagging a release. The limiter also requires the shared signing key for quota tokens, set on the following line of the env file.

vault entry, yahaf-tagug: LEDGER_TOKEN20=884d77d1a8b98aa4edfb